发表于2005年10月的文章

本本又被拿回去了

发表于2005年10月28日
联想的售后支持又把本拿回去了。现在机器主板应该没有问题了,开机还挺快,不过音频线被某个哥们给卡在缝隙里,导致左边喇叭不响… 明天再送回来~
他们客服的态度太好了,也确实认真,我也不好和人动怒。
可能因为这不是自己的本吧~如果是自己的就不会这么想了~
 
盼望明天本本能平安归来~

本本还是有问题

发表于2005年10月21日
联想的人给换了主板,但最不愿看到的事情发生了,这个板子有问题。在客服验机在BIOS里重启了一次,进系统后发觉比原先慢了。回来后03下xp下都发生了停止响应只能拔电源才能关机。
明天进城,再去一趟客服~
坚决不能换主板了~
郁闷!

计划紧张进行,每天多少有些收获

发表于2005年10月17日
从暑假与孙文见面,到现在2个多月了,一直在为11月的那一天做准备。有点像当时要考大学的感觉。每天复习的都是原来不喜欢学的东西,不过看了进去还是很有意思的,做了这么多东西回回炉收获颇多。
“One thousand lines per day! ” 这听起来比李开复的要求还要高。不知道没算过,也不知道改怎么算。每天几百行应该有了~
又重新拾起底层的东西。高层的东西都是基于底层构建的,用起来简单了许多,但也少了技巧性。反过来如果没有什么技巧而言,没有了难度大家都一样了。看了许多面经string programming应该是必考的东西,而且以前也亲身经历过。考察这方面的问题是惯例。
一个真正的大公司不会在乎你会用JBuilder还是Eclipse,VC还是.NET。对工具的掌握都不重要。这些东西在培训期间完全可以学会,精通也没有问题。他们应该会考查你数据结构,指针,异常处理…
为了一篇作业憋了两天了… 今天一定要照着想好的框架写出来…

Win2KPro 改成 Win2KServer~并解IIS连接数限制

发表于2005年10月13日

数字印院道路曲折,终于把2000pro改称server了~,ntswitch有用,但需重装iis,如果报500错误,则需要一下解决方法。

问题起因:

IIS已经启动但是web无法使用 IE返回500内部错误 记录如下

由于在下列系统 API 错误,COM+ 服务无法初始化。它通常是由本地计算机的系统资源存储问题引起的。
CryptAcquireContext
进程名称: dllhost.exe
该错误的严重性已导致进程终止。
错误代码= 0×80090017 : 提供程序类型未被定义。
COM+ 服务内部信息:
文件: .\security.cpp, 行: 615

服务器 {3D14228D-FBE1-11D0-995D-00C04FD919C1} 没有在限定的时间内用 DCOM 注册。

服务器未能转入应用程序 ‘/LM/W3SVC/1/ROOT/webmail’。错误是 ‘服务器运行失败
‘。
若要获取关于此消息的更多的信息,请访问 Microsoft 联机支持站点: http://www.microsoft.com/contentredirect.asp 。

答:

IIS 500内部错误之解决办法(一.错误表现)
沧海笑一声 发表于 9/10/2001 8:17:09 AM NT世界 ←返回版面

一.错误表现
这个错误发生时总会有三方面的表现:一是IE中的最直接的表现,也是最让人看不懂的表现;二是安全日志中的表现,IWAM_Machine账号登录失败;三是系统日志中的表现,IIS Out-Of-Process Pooled Applications应用程序因启动账号的错误而不能够启动.从而造成ASP页面浏览错误.

(一)IE中的表现

当浏览以前能够正常运行的asp页面时会出现如下的错误:

(1)
网页无法显示
您要访问的网页存在问题,因此无法显示。

———————————————

请尝试下列操作:

打开 http://127.0.0.1 主页,寻找指向所需信息的链接。
单击刷新按钮,或者以后重试。

HTTP 500 – 内部服务器错误
Internet 信息服务

——————————————————————————–

技术信息(支持个人)

详细信息:
Microsoft 支持

[注意,这儿只是500错误,不是500.xx等错误的,那些错误主要是asp编程问题,与iis没有太大的关系,只有500错误是由iis自身造成的]

(2)
Server Application Error
The server has encountered an error while loading an application during the processing of your request. Please refer to the event log for more detail information. Please contact the server administrator for assistance.

(二)安全日志记录(2条)
事件类型: 失败审核
事件来源: Security
事件种类: 登录/注销
事件 ID: 529
日期: 2001-9-9
事件: 11:17:07
用户: NT AUTHORITY\SYSTEM
计算机: MYSERVER
描述:
登录失败:
原因: 用户名未知或密码错误
用户名: IWAM_MYSERVER
域: MYDOM
登录类型: 4
登录过程: Advapi
身份验证程序包: MICROSOFT_AUTHENTICATION_PACKAGE_V1_0
工作站名: MYSERVER

事件类型: 失败审核
事件来源: Security
事件种类: 帐户登录
事件 ID: 681
日期: 2001-9-9
事件: 11:17:07
用户: NT AUTHORITY\SYSTEM
计算机: MYSERVER
描述:
登录到帐户: IWAM_MYSERVER
登录的用户: MICROSOFT_AUTHENTICATION_PACKAGE_V1_0
从工作站: MYSERVER
未成功。错误代码是: 3221225578

注:IWAM_MYSERVER,启动进程之外的应用程序的 Internet 信息服务的内置帐号,安装IIS时自动建立,其密码由IIS控制.

(三)系统日志中的记录(2条)
事件类型: 错误
事件来源: DCOM
事件种类: 无
事件 ID: 10004
日期: 2001-9-9
事件: 11:20:26
用户: N/A
计算机: MYSERVER
描述:
DCOM 遇到错误”无法更新密码。提供给新密码的值包含密码中不允许的值。 “并且无法登录到 .\IWAM_MYSERVER 上以运行服务器:
{3D14228D-FBE1-11D0-995D-00C04FD919C1}

事件类型: 警告
事件来源: W3SVC
事件种类: 无
事件 ID: 36
日期: 2001-9-9
事件: 11:20:26
用户: N/A
计算机: MYSERVER
描述:
服务器未能转入应用程序 ‘/LM/W3SVC/4/Root’。错误是 ‘RunAs 的格式必须是<域名>\<用户名>或只是<用户名>
‘。
若要获取关于此消息的更多的信息,请访问 Microsoft 联机支持站点: http://www.microsoft.com/contentredirect.asp 。

注:3D14228D-FBE1-11D0-995D-00C04FD919C1}实际是IIS Out-Of-Process Pooled Applications 的KEY.也就是代表IIS Out-Of-Process Pooled Applications.
================================
IIS 500内部错误之解决办法(二.错误原因与解决办法)
沧海笑一声 发表于 9/10/2001 8:40:41 AM NT世界 ←返回版面

出现IIS 500内部错误的原因有多个,但最主要的原因是IWAM_MACHINE账号在Active Directory(或SAM),IIS的metabase数据库与COM+组件中的密码不匹配不同步最成的.因此解决问题的关键在于使这三方的密码同步起来.
要使这三方的密码同步,有几种办法,下面只介绍最好用的一种,使用IIS自带的脚本进行密码同步(看来微软早就知道这方面的问题了,因此专门做了一个密码同步的脚本.:)):

操作如下:
1.在本地账号管理器或AD用户与计算机中更改IWAM_MACHINE账号的密码.假设我们改为12345678.[本来这个账号是计算机控制的,非常复杂].
2.使用新的密码重设IIS Metabase数据库.我们需要使用IIS自带的管理脚本adsutil.运行如下的命令:
c:\Inetpub\AdminScripts> adsutil SET w3svc/WAMUserPass 12345678

系统会显示:
WAMUserPass: (String) 12345678

提示密码更新成功.

通常情况下IIS会自动与系统账号等信息同步,但我发现我的机器上ISUR_MACHINE是同步的,但IWAM_MACHINE总是不同步,因此只好自行修改了.

3.同步COM+账号密码
同样我们要用到IIS的管理脚本synciwam.vbs,这个脚本通常会存在于c:\inetpub\adminscripts下,上一个管理脚本也在这儿放着.
命令如下:
cscript c:\inetpub\adminscripts\synciwam.vbs -v

-v参数是打开详细模式,让我们看到更新的过程,通常会如下显示:

Microsoft (R) Windows Script Host Version 5.6
版权所有(C) Microsoft Corporation 1996-2000。保留所有权利。

WamUserNameIWAM_MYSERVER
WamUserPass12345678
IIS Applications Defined:
Name, AppIsolated, Package ID
w3svc, 0, {3D14228C-FBE1-11d0-995D-00C04FD919C1}
Root, 2,
IISHelp, 2,
IISAdmin, 2,
IISSamples, 2,
MSADC, 2,
ROOT, 2,
IISAdmin, 2,
IISHelp, 2,
Root, 2,
Root, 2,

Out of process applications defined:
Count: 1
{3D14228D-FBE1-11d0-995D-00C04FD919C1}

Updating Applications:
Name: IIS Out-Of-Process Pooled Applications Key: {3D14228D-FBE1-11D0-995D-00C04
FD919C1}

密码同步成功.如果不成功先看一下这个脚本取的IIS的密码正确不正确,如果不正确请重复第二步同步IIS密码.

问题解闷,再打开IIS看看,ASP程序应该能够正常浏览了.

忙~不过有所得~

发表于2005年10月13日
经营每天的生活真挺累。幸亏现在还不用养家…
经常在外面跑,人心都跑浮了。还是得有过硬的技术不然随时都会被人取代。大家都不能算是特别专业的,谁都可以多项选择,谁都可以被别人替代。不过想到能有多少公司是特别专业的。我不专业,那什么才算专业?
咋说的时候想的时候内容还挺多,写的时候却总是卡壳。这是基本能力啊!文档~我永远的痛…
拷来拷去一份文档变成了六份文档,冗余?不…我做该做的工作收该收的钱,别的我恐怕也改变不了。100块钱不少~
大家都想要钱,这妇女想用自己的小工,他们肯定做不了这么专业,挺希望能给小飞雪他们拉到这个活。想省钱没错,不过到时候向客户收费肯定也要不高。何况我们只是挣的劳务。
没准这是个必须过程,当真的都有了钱,人们可能才会想象其他东西,目前来说钱还是最让人看中的。我也太想钱了,看着将近百米的走廊这么多觉着挺没用的科室,突然有种可怕的设想,如果我坐进了这种办公室,我会不会贪~ 害怕进这样的办公室,我宁愿每天到处跑,去不同的地方,解决不同的问题。
恐怕我坐在那我比他们都会贪~